Major Hazards on Construction Sites- Construction involves buildings going up and coming down, as well as excavations and the building of trenches.
- When working practices are disorganized and rushed, such as undertaking electrical work in wet conditions or using non-professionals to complete electrical work, electricity presents additional hazards.
- Failure to use PPE correctly or using damaged or inadequate PPE can mean that workers are exposed to harmful materials such as asbestos and long-term risk from dust particles (emanating from plaster, brick, stone).
